Sonar

Phần mềm chụp màn hình:
Sonar
Các chi tiết về phần mềm:
Phiên bản: 2.11
Ngày tải lên: 11 May 15
Nhà phát triển: The Sonar Team
Giấy phép: Miễn phí
Phổ biến: 4

Rating: nan/5 (Total Votes: 0)

Sonar là một nền tảng mở để quản lý chất lượng mã. Như vậy, nó bao gồm trong phiên bản cốt lõi của nó các trục 7 về chất lượng mã.
Sonar đã có một cách rất hiệu quả để điều hướng, một sự cân bằng giữa cái nhìn cấp cao, TimeMachine, bảng điều khiển và săn khiếm khuyết cụ & nbsp;. Điều này cho phép nhanh chóng phát hiện ra các dự án và / hoặc các thành phần có trong nợ kỹ thuật để thiết lập kế hoạch hành động.
Sonar là một ứng dụng dựa trên web. Nội quy, thông báo, ngưỡng, loại trừ, cài đặt & hellip; có thể được cấu hình trực tuyến. Bằng cách tận dụng cơ sở dữ liệu của nó, Sonar không chỉ cho phép kết hợp các số liệu hoàn toàn nhưng cũng để trộn chúng với các biện pháp lịch sử.
Bao gồm các ngôn ngữ mới, thêm những quy tắc cơ, tính toán số liệu tiên tiến có thể được thực hiện thông qua một cơ chế mở rộng mạnh mẽ. Hơn 20 sung đã có sẵn, bao gồm:
& Nbsp; * Java
& Nbsp; * PL / SQL
. & Nbsp; * nợ kỹ thuật

là gì mới trong phiên bản này:

  • phát hiện Cross-dự án mã trùng lặp
  • TimeMachine 2.0:. Replay sự tiến hóa của bất kỳ chất lượng số liệu và theo dõi nó cùng với bảng điều khiển

là gì mới trong phiên bản 2.10:

dịch vụ

  • Phiên bản này cho biết thêm quốc tế, các biện pháp sử dụng, và thông báo.

là gì mới trong phiên bản 2.7:

  • phát hành này thêm hỗ trợ cho bảo hiểm theo dõi bằng xét nghiệm đơn vị trên mới / mã nguồn cập nhật.
  • Đồng thời, sự tích hợp giữa Sonar và SCM đã trở thành chặt chẽ hơn nhiều.

là gì mới trong phiên bản 2.6:

  • [SONAR-1481] - Cho phép mở rộng FindBugs
  • [SONAR-2106] - New Java thư viện để bootstrap phân tích dự án
  • [SONAR-2123] - chú thích mới để cho phép chỉ định trong các môi trường mà BatchExtension cần được hoạt động
  • [SONAR-2148] - thuộc tính mới để quản lý mức độ ngôn ngữ Java
  • [SONAR-2151] - bất động sản mới để quản lý mã nguồn
  • [SONAR-2172] - API: điểm mở rộng mới - Initializer

là gì mới trong phiên bản 2.4:

  • phát hành này thêm khả năng để tạo ra các bảng điều khiển tùy chỉnh, quản lý plugins từ trình duyệt, và để xác định các quy tắc kiến ​​trúc.
  • Nó có hỗ trợ cho Maven 3.

là gì mới trong phiên bản 2.3:

  • Các khả năng kích hoạt một quy tắc mã hóa nhiều lần, sao lưu và khôi phục lại hồ sơ chất lượng, và kích hoạt tất cả các quy tắc được trả về bởi một tìm kiếm cùng một lúc.
  • Một quy tắc API mới. Khả năng thêm các tài nguyên tĩnh để plugins.
  • Hỗ trợ cho các mô hình chất lượng (ví dụ như ISO 9126) thông qua một meta-mô hình mới.
  • Một API mới và mới FindBugs quy định.

là gì mới trong phiên bản 2.2:

  • Có ba tính năng chính trong phiên bản này: bộ lọc, yêu thích , và classloaders plugin.
  • Ngày đầu của những người ba tính năng, phiên bản này có chứa hơn 60 cải tiến và sửa lỗi, bao gồm nâng cấp Checkstyle / PMD và hỗ trợ của Clover 3.

là gì mới trong phiên bản 1.12:

  • Tính năng mới:
  • [SONAR-61] - Liên kết để cai trị mô tả từ một vi phạm hiển thị trong trình xem tài nguyên
  • [SONAR-630] - Sonar nên có một quản lý sử dụng đầy đủ
  • [SONAR-675] - Colorize mã nguồn trong trình xem Resource
  • [SONAR-972] - Cung cấp một Sonar cách chung chung để khóa các mã nguồn để ngăn chặn hành vi vi phạm: // NOSONAR
  • [SONAR-1180] - thêm ignoreLiterals tùy chọn CPD và ignoreIdentifiers
  • [SONAR-1224] - API: điểm mở rộng mới để thêm mã colorization về ngôn ngữ mới
  • [SONAR-1264] - điểm mở rộng mới: quản lý bên ngoài của các mật khẩu người dùng
  • Cải tiến:
  • [SONAR-658] - Bao gồm các Plugin Tên trong vi phạm Chú thích
  • [SONAR-840] - thế hệ JSON Nhanh hơn
  • [SONAR-881] - Sử dụng @ Override chú thích để tránh đếm undocumentedAPI khi trọng API công cộng
  • [SONAR-1018] - NoClassDefFoundError là không chính xác xử lý bởi các plugin Sonar Maven
  • [SONAR-1044] - Cho phép thay đổi màu sắc trên quy mô treemap
  • [SONAR-1075] - Chuẩn hóa cách & quot; Best Value & quot; được quản lý trên Metric
  • [SONAR-1146] - Thêm các số API công cộng trong Viewer Resource header
  • [SONAR-1147] - Thêm đường dẫn tập tin đầy đủ trong Viewer Resource header
  • [SONAR-1157] - Thêm & quot; dòng Uncovered & quot; và & quot; điều kiện Uncovered & quot; trong & quot; phủ sóng & quot; tab của Viewer Resource
  • [SONAR-1176] - Thêm các ID chính thức của quy tắc trong mô tả của quy tắc
  • [SONAR-1177] - Phân tích báo cáo Chắc chắn là quá chậm
  • [SONAR-1184] - API: nâng cấp lên commons-codec 1.4
  • [SONAR-1186] - Thêm các điều khiển MS SQLServer để classpath
  • [SONAR-1190] - Hãy nhanh trang đưa xuống
  • [SONAR-1193] - Rule & quot; & quot tự nhập khẩu; bỏ sót bất động sản & quot; Tùy chọn & quot; trong màn hình cấu hình
  • [SONAR-1202] - Nâng cao yêu cầu SQL được sử dụng bởi Sonar webservice để có được tên snapshot
  • [SONAR-1214] - ưu tiên mặc định của quy tắc UWF_FIELD_NOT_INITIALIZED_IN_CONSTRUCTOR FindBugs phải là nhỏ
  • [SONAR-1215] - ưu tiên mặc định của quy tắc OBL_UNSATISFIED_OBLIGATION FindBugs phải là nhỏ
  • [SONAR-1219] - Đổi độ ưu tiên mặc định của SIC_INNER_SHOULD_BE_STATIC_ANON FindBugs quy luật từ phê bình đối với chính
  • [SONAR-1220] - Đổi độ ưu tiên mặc định của SIC_INNER_SHOULD_BE_STATIC_NEEDS_THIS FindBugs quy luật từ phê bình đối với chính
  • [SONAR-1221] - Đổi độ ưu tiên mặc định của CI_CONFUSED_INHERITANCE FindBugs quy luật từ phê bình đối với nhánh
  • [SONAR-1222] - Đổi độ ưu tiên mặc định của RV_CHECK_FOR_POSITIVE_INDEXOF FindBugs quy luật từ phê bình đối với nhánh
  • [SONAR-1223] - Đổi độ ưu tiên mặc định của DM_CONVERT_CASE FindBugs lệ từ chính đến Thông tin
  • [SONAR-1226] - Do một số làm sạch theo cách Coremetrics được tổ chức trong các lĩnh vực
  • [SONAR-1245] - Thêm tiêu đề cho các treemap
  • [SONAR-1246] - Các mô tả về rule PMD 'Close tài nguyên' là không rõ ràng
  • [SONAR-1248] - constructor rỗng không nên được coi là API công cộng
  • [SONAR-1250] - Cải thiện cung Sao chép Density trong các thành phần treemap
  • [SONAR-1251] - Hãy chọn số liệu của miền trong các thành phần treemap
  • [SONAR-1258] - Nâng cấp lên XStream 1.3.1
  • [SONAR-1259] - title theo ngữ cảnh của các trang HTML
  • [SONAR-1261] - Cải thiện kịch bản để xây dựng tập tin chiến tranh để ngăn chặn bất kỳ việc sử dụng các cài đặt cục bộ phiên bản ANT
  • [SONAR-1285] - Nâng cao yêu cầu SQL phụ trách thiết snapshots.isLast cột 0
  • [SONAR-1293] - Không có bản ghi khi vẽ một widget Plugin không
  • Bug:
  • [SONAR-1115] -. Kết quả xét nghiệm loại trừ từ tĩnh phân tích cũng ngăn chặn Chắc chắn (JUnit)
  • [SONAR-1155] - Khi lựa chọn một chỉ số này chỉ có giá trị không ở các treemap (kích thước trục), nó không được làm mới
  • [SONAR-1164] - tài sản sonar.jdbc.dialect không đúng cách khởi tạo các phương ngữ activerecord sử dụng
  • [SONAR-1165] - Sonar là sử dụng các shema sai trong Oracle XE khi chạy hai trường hợp với các phiên bản khác nhau
  • [SONAR-1172] - giá trị mặc định xấu đối với các quy tắc Checkstyle & quot; TypeName & quot; trong & quot; Sun kiểm tra & quot; hồ sơ
  • [SONAR-1182] - Không thể mở ResourceViewer để hiển thị mã nguồn
  • [SONAR-1188] - hiện vật sonar-mực và sonar-plug-api có tổng kiểm tra không hợp lệ
  • [SONAR-1203] - thất bại để tẩy cơ sở dữ liệu Oracle với lỗi ORA-01.795
  • [SONAR-1206] - Bắt một Lỗi HTTP 404 dẫn đến một vòng lặp trong url / dự án
  • [SONAR-1217] - Tắt tạm thời EQ_DOESNT_OVERRIDE_EQUALS quy tắc FindBugs
  • [SONAR-1218] - Đổi độ ưu tiên mặc định của SIC_INNER_SHOULD_BE_STATIC FindBugs quy luật từ phê bình đối với chính
  • [SONAR-1233] - Nhận xét LỘC metric không nên tính phương pháp GWT bản
  • [SONAR-1235] - LỘC Commented quá hăng hái
  • [SONAR-1236] - bộ nhớ cache của trình duyệt phải được làm sạch khi nâng cấp Sonar
  • [SONAR-1237] - khoản tiền trả không hợp lệ cho sonar-mực và sonar-plugin-api tại http://repository.codehaus.org
  • [SONAR-1253] - Không thể cập nhật liên kết dự án trong cài đặt
  • [SONAR-1275] - Lỗi khi chạy lần đầu tiên với PostgreSQL 8.2: ActiveRecord :: ActiveRecordError: ERROR: giá trị quá dài cho loại nhân vật khác nhau (9)
  • [SONAR-1292] - Không thể hiển thị piechart khi không có dữ liệu
  • [SONAR-1294] - Xóa một metric dẫn không bao giờ kết thúc
  • [SONAR-1303] - cơ chế colorizer luật không xử lý nhân vật một cách chính xác dấu gạch chéo ngược
  • Wish:
  • [SONAR-701] - Thời gian hết trong sonar máy chủ kết nối HTTP phải được cấu hình

Phần mềm tương tự

NoseDBReport
NoseDBReport

20 Feb 15

Sipbomber
Sipbomber

3 Jun 15

van.pg
van.pg

14 Apr 15

BuildBot
BuildBot

17 Feb 15

Ý kiến ​​để Sonar

Bình luận không
Nhập bình luận
Bật hình ảnh!